Documentos de Académico
Documentos de Profesional
Documentos de Cultura
lenguajes de
programación
Materia: metodología de programación
Maestra: Marcela Álvarez Vivanco
Alumna: Laura Paola Rios Barrera
Área: Tecnologías de la Información y Comunicación
Grupo: TI 1A
1
Índice
Portada ………………… 1
Índice ……………………. 2
Introducción …………. 3
¿Qué es lenguaje
de programación ……………… 4
¿Qué tipos de
lenguaje existen ……………… 4
¿Para que sirve el
lenguaje de
programación? ……………… 5
¿Qué software de
programación
existen? ……………… 6
Conclusión ……………… 7
Bibliografía ……………… 8
2
Introducción
Según la definición teórica lenguaje se entiende a un
sistema de comunicación que posee una determinada
estructura, contenido y uso; por otro lado la
programación es un vocabulario propio de la
informática es el procedimiento de escritura del código
fuente de un software.
De esta manera, podemos decir que la programación
le indica al programa informático que acción tiene que
llevar a cabo y cual es el modo en que debe hacerlo.
Con estas nociones es claro que podemos decir que
un lenguaje de programación es aquella estructura que
en cierta base sintáctica y semántica, imparte distintas
instrucciones a un programa y este lo cumpla para
llevar a cabo la función que se le a dado
A continuación se explicara brevemente como funciona
el lenguaje de programación en sus diferentes áreas.
3
¿Qué es el lenguaje de programación?
Un lenguaje de programación en un conjunto de símbolo y códigos
usados para orientar la programación de estructuras en el desarrollo
web.
Es un lenguaje formal que, mediante una serie de instrucciones, le
permite a un programador escribir un conjunto de órdenes, acciones
consecutivas, datos y algoritmos para, de esa forma, crear programas
que controlen el comportamiento físico y lógico de una máquina.
Mediante este lenguaje se comunican el programador y la máquina,
permitiendo especificar, de forma precisa, aspectos como:
• cuáles datos debe operar un software específico;
• cómo deben ser almacenados o transmitidos esos datos;
• las acciones que debe tomar el software dependiendo de las
circunstancias variables.
Para explicarlo mejor, el lenguaje de programación es un sistema
estructurado de comunicación, el cual está conformado por conjuntos
de símbolos, palabras claves, reglas semánticas y sintácticas que
permiten el entendimiento entre un programador y una máquina.
6
❖ Interpretadores o traductores
Como leíste en éste artículo, el traductor (o intérprete) carga el código
ingresado y traduce las instrucciones para que el programa pueda ser
ejecutado.
❖ IDE
El IDE (Integrated Development Environment) o Entorno de Desarrollo
Integrado, es una aplicación informática que proporciona una serie de
servicios que facilitan la programación de software, tales como:
• funciones de autocompletado;
• un editor de código fuente;
• gestión de conexiones a bases de datos;
• integración con sistemas de control de versiones;
• simuladores de dispositivos;
• un depurador para agilizar el proceso de desarrollo de software,
entre otros.
Conclusión
Los lenguajes de alto nivel se desarrollaron con el objetivo de
ser más accesibles y entendibles por la mayoría de
programadores, de manera que los programadores pudieran
concentrarse más en resolver la tarea o los problemas y no en
el lenguaje que la maquina tenía que entender.
C++ surge de fusionar dos ideas: la eficiencia del lenguaje C
para poder acceder al hardware al ejecutar tareas que
realmente demandaban recursos de memoria; y las ideas de
abstracción que representan las el nuevo conceptos de clases
y objetos.
El lenguaje C++ presenta grandes herramientas de desarrollo
para los programadores como las funciones, bibliotecas,
clases y los objetos. De manera que el programador se ocupa
de utilizar dichas herramientas para resolver un problema
específico.
7
Bibliografía
RockContent. (20 de Abril de 2019). RockContent. Obtenido de
RockContent:
https://rockcontent.com/es/blog/que-es-un-lenguaje-de-
programacion/
Ceballos, F. J. (2004). Enciclopedia del lenguaje C. México:
Alfaomega/RaMa.
https://programas.cuaed.unam.mx/repositorio/moodle/pluginfile.p
hp/1023/mod_resource/content/1/contenido/index.html